OPINION OF THE COURT

On review of submissions pursuant to section 500.4 of the Rules of the Court of Appeals (22 NYCRR 500.4), order af*890firmed. The Appellate Division did not err as a matter of law in dismissing the appeal from an execution of judgment to that court.

Concur: Chief Judge Wachtler and Judges Simons, Kaye, Titone, Hancock, Jr., and Bellacosa.
